1. A pedestrian collision determination system comprising:
a collision detection sensor system including:
a conductive pattern disposed on a front surface of a shock absorber of a vehicle bumper, the conductive pattern being configured to form an electromagnetic field by an application of alternating current power, and
a conductive material disposed at a position facing the conductive pattern on an inner surface of a bumper skin of the vehicle bumper; and
a control unit comprising at least one circuit configured to determine an occurrence or non-occurrence of a pedestrian collision based on a change of a current flowing in the conductive pattern, wherein the at least one circuit of the control unit is configured to calculate a mass and a stiffness of a colliding object based on the magnitude of the peak value of the current flowing in the conductive pattern and the vibration frequency of the peak value and, based on the determination result, determine whether the colliding object is a pedestrian by comparing the calculated stiffness with a set range indicative of a pedestrian stiffness comprising a maximum stiffness value and a minimum stiffness value and the calculated mass with a pre-defined value.
